In a major content deal, Fox Sports has partnered with Barstool Sports to bring some of the brand's most prominent figures to its biggest shows. The collaboration will see Barstool founder Dave Portnoy become a regular contributor to "Big Noon Kickoff" and other personalities, including Dan "Big Cat" Katz, make frequent appearances.

Outside of Portnoy, Katz is arguably Barstool's most prominent figure, co-hosting the podcast "Pardon My Take," which has over two million combined followers on Twitter and Instagram. Katz has been with the brand since 2012, and with the new partnership, he has a new role on college football Saturdays.
Here's what to expect from Katz on "Big Noon Kickoff."
What is Dan Katz's role on Fox's "Big Noon Kickoff?"
Katz, along with Barstool names like Portnoy and Brandon Walker, will make on-site appearances on the campus-sets of "Big Noon Kickoff."
He made his first appearance in Ames, Iowa for the Iowa-Iowa State matchup, which the Cyclones won 16-13.

Will Dan Katz be on "Big Noon Kickoff" this week?
Katz will be on Week 3's edition of "Big Noon Kickoff," which will be live from Northwestern University in Evanston, Illinois. The Wildcats take on the No. 4 Oregon Ducks, setting up a high-profile showdown at Northwestern Medicine Field at Martin Stadium.

Is Big Cat from Chicago?
Though he has adopted Chicago sports as his own, Katz was not born in the area. He was born and raised near Boston, Massachusetts before moving to the Chicagoland area in 2007.
He adopted Chicago teams as his own after moving there and made it a significant part of his blogging and podcasting career.

When will "Big Noon Kickoff" air?
"Big Noon Kickoff" will go live at 9 a.m. ET on Saturday. It will air from Northwestern's campus, which is right on the shore of Lake Michigan.
